Who do cows produce for us?

Cows produce several things for us, including:

* Milk: This is the most common product we get from cows. It can be consumed directly, or used to make cheese, yogurt, butter, ice cream, and many other dairy products.

* Beef: This is the meat from cows, and it is a major source of protein in many diets around the world.

* Leather: The hides of cows are used to make leather, which is used for a wide variety of products, including clothing, shoes, belts, and furniture.

* Manure: Cow manure is a valuable fertilizer and can be used to improve soil quality. It can also be used to generate biogas, which can be used as a renewable energy source.

* Other products: Cows also produce things like gelatin, tallow, and bone meal, which are used in various industries.
